A typical Italian hotel of about the 1970's. Clean, convenient, and comfortable enough if you are willing to deal with the shower situation (tub with hand shower only) and the famous matrimonial bed (2 twins made up together). It was quite inexpensive. The decor is very plain and basic. The breakfast is quite acceptable. Our room had a balcony with a view of the countryside - very nice! The walk into town is fine and only takes about 10 minutes. Convenient parking is free and right behind the hotel. The staff were all pleasant and friendly. They do not speak much English, but we didn't find it a problem (our Italian is minimal).

I will preface this review by disclosing that I am quite familiar with Urbino, having studied two separate summers on "campus"; so, I did know my way around, though I could see how it would be frustrating to arrive at this hotel if you don't. Despite the fact that this hotel is slightly outside city walls and requires either walking up at least one lengthy hill (two if you're going to take via Mazzini and then via Raffaelo from Borgo Mercatale), and preferably a taxi or 1.50Euro ride on the n.3 pullman for the initial ride there with your luggage, it is actually - as others have said - a mere 15 minute walk from the city center. The rooms are clean, relatively spacious, with a small tv and plenty of drawer/armoir space. The bathroom I had was immaculate and looked like it was scrubbed down every day. They don't have air conditioning in the rooms, but they do in the lobby. The included breakfast is the simple water/milk/coffee/juice and croissants/bread/ham/cheese/cereal one you'll find at many Italian hotels. The staff is quite friendly and helpful, and will be more than happy to assist you with directions towards the city center or anything else in the vicinity. Wi-Fi is available throughout the hotel. I paid 30Euro/night for this hotel, even taking into account the weekend (Thursday - Tuesday) in a more touristy month (July), and including breakfast. Even though Urbino is a relatively cheap city, if you're willing to walk a bit (which you're going to do anywhere in Italy - live a little!), and don't mind staying slightly outside the city's walls, this hotel is one of the best values available.

The name of a great artist is not enough to make this hotel a great hotel. Our room was spacious enough but there was no air conditioner, the room is heated by a radiator that we could not control, so we could warm up with only a blanket. The hair dryer did not work, as well as the bathroom lights on the console. The breakfast was missing some key ingredients: there were only a few sweets, no ham, no cheese, no salty food. In addition, coffee and other hot drinks were served by an automatic dispenser. Finally, when we returned to our room after breakfast we found the cleaning lady who was already rearranging the room and had already changed the towels, even if we had not yet left and we still had all our things inside the room: this is not is professional in our opinion. For what regards the location, the hotel is about a kilometer from the city walls, around which there is paid parking and free parking. However, you can leave your car near the hotel and get to the city by bus, the stop is right outside the hotel. Let's say the accommodation was not so bad but other hotels, for the same price, gave us greater satisfaction.
